Notes:
Borden Sale, American Art Gallery, 17-19 February 1913, lot 812. Rains Galleries, New York, NY, 27 November 1935 (W.D. Breaker sale), lot 688, bought in by Breaker. Purchased from William D. Breaker (through G.A. Baker) by W.S. Lewis, 1939.
Bound as page 180 in volume 11 of M.C.D. Borden's extensively extra-illustrated copy of: Horace Walpole and his world : select passages from his letters / edited by L. B. Seeley ... London : Seeley, Jackson, and Halliday, 1884.
Page reference for quotation written below title: Page 262.
Place of production inferred from artist's city of residence during this time period.
Signed and dated by the artist in lower left corner of image.
Title written at bottom of image.
Abstract:
Composite image made up of ten small rectangular views of English scenery, some drawn to overlap and partially obscure others. One of the small views shows a city scene, with a bridge and cathedral visible; all the other views show the English countryside, with fields, trees, roads, small houses, and bodies of water prominent. A few human figures are visible, including a man on horseback, a man lying on a hill, and people riding in a carriage. The rectangular views are set against a gray background pattern with images of leaves, flowers, and birds.
